Pembroke Welsh Corgi vs Yorkshire Terrier
People compare Pembroke Welsh Corgis and Yorkshire Terriers because they’re both small, big-personality dogs that fit in apartments and love their people fiercely. But that’s where the similarities end. Choosing between them isn’t just about size. it’s about lifestyle, energy flow, and what kind of chaos you’re ready for. The Corgi is a herding dog with a work ethic. They’re smart, intense, and always “on.” At 30 pounds, they’re built like go-karts with ears, and they’ll use that energy to round up kids, cats, or even vacuum cleaners if you’re not giving them direction. They shed like it’s their job. year-round, and heavily. and they bark with purpose. They’re affectionate, yes, but they need jobs. Agility, obedience, long walks. they thrive on structure. If you’re active and want a dog that’s both a partner and a watchdog, the Corgi’s your match. The Yorkie, at just 7 pounds, packs that same energy into a purse-sized body. They don’t shed much, making them a go-to for allergy-prone homes, but don’t mistake their size for ease. They’re sprightly, bold, and need just as much mental stimulation. But their fragility is real. Toddlers can injure them by accident, and they can be wiped out by a careless step or a scuffle with a larger dog. They adapt beautifully to city life, but they demand attention and consistency. Here’s the truth beyond the data: both dogs are high-maintenance in different ways. The Corgi needs space to move and a job to do. The Yorkie needs protection and constant involvement in your life. Pick the Corgi if you want a dog that works with you. Pick the Yorkie if you want a tiny velcro companion who treats life like an adventure. Just don’t expect either to be a couch ornament. They’re both too busy running the household.
